首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

kubectl日志-f获取“授权错误”

kubectl是Kubernetes的命令行工具,用于管理和操作Kubernetes集群。kubectl日志-f获取“授权错误”是指在使用kubectl命令时,通过-f参数获取Pod的日志时出现了授权错误。

授权错误通常是由于当前用户没有足够的权限来执行该操作所导致的。解决这个问题的方法是确保当前用户具有足够的权限来获取Pod的日志。

在腾讯云的Kubernetes集群中,可以通过以下步骤来解决授权错误:

  1. 确认当前用户是否具有足够的权限。可以使用kubectl命令来查看当前用户的权限配置:
  2. 确认当前用户是否具有足够的权限。可以使用kubectl命令来查看当前用户的权限配置:
  3. 其中,<verb>是操作动词(如get、list、watch、log等),<resource>是资源类型(如pods、deployments、services等)。如果返回"yes"表示当前用户具有该权限,否则表示没有权限。
  4. 如果当前用户没有足够的权限,可以通过以下方式来授予权限:
    • 修改当前用户的角色绑定,将其添加到具有足够权限的角色中。
    • 创建一个新的角色,并将其绑定到当前用户上。
  • 在腾讯云的Kubernetes集群中,推荐使用腾讯云容器服务(Tencent Kubernetes Engine,TKE)来管理和操作集群。TKE提供了丰富的权限管理功能,可以通过访问管理(CAM)来控制用户的权限。具体的权限管理操作可以参考腾讯云的文档:TKE权限管理

总结: kubectl日志-f获取“授权错误”是指在使用kubectl命令获取Pod的日志时出现了授权错误。解决这个问题的方法是确保当前用户具有足够的权限来执行该操作。在腾讯云的Kubernetes集群中,可以通过修改角色绑定或创建新角色,并将其绑定到当前用户上来授予权限。推荐使用腾讯云容器服务(TKE)来管理和操作集群,并通过腾讯云的访问管理(CAM)来进行权限管理。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Php公众号40029,网页授权获取微信用户信息错误40029:不合法的oauth_code

    这几天测试刚完成的网页授权获取微信用户信息功能。 在第一步:用户同意授权获取code,通过code获取access_token时,有时会出现40029错误。...我这也是40029错误,根据日志中数据分析,不止是2次,基本是个位数,然后最多的就是123、78、70、65(只是一天的数据4台机器),时间点是10:37:04~16:11:06(偏差在5分钟内),我也是醉了...利用CODE可以获取到aceess_token,不注释,则获得的CODE获取acccess_token时提示40029 原因不明 跳转到微信网页授权地址时,try-catch一下,如果出现报错,重新获取授权就行...通过code获取不到静默授权的微信openid。...2)微信给的code就不是合法的code,从服务器的日志可以查到,同一个code,只请求了一次,也会有失败的情况发生,出现错误代码40029。

    4.6K10

    Linkerd服务网格中的Ingress流量管理与服务限制

    inject -|kubectl apply -f - # 删除原有pods,进行更新 kubectl delete pods -n ingress-nginx ingress-nginx-controller...可以看到 HTTP 流量 当应用程序返回错误(如 5xx HTTP 状态代码)时,这将在 Linkerd UI 中看到,不仅是应用程序,还有 nginx ingress 控制器,因为它向客户端返回错误代码...-|kubectl apply -f - # 删除原有pods,进行更新 kubectl delete pods -n traefik traefik-v2-55755bbc8b-nbwx8 这里需要注意如果还是使用...现在没有客户端被授权访问此服务,正常会看到成功率有所下降, 因为从 Web 服务到 Voting 的请求开始被拒绝,也可以直接查看 Web 服务的 Pod 日志来验证: $ kubectl logs -...,所以该请求将被拒绝并显示 PermissionDenied 错误。

    17710

    K8s命令篇-Kubernetes工作实用命令集结号

    在一条命令中操作多个对象示例 #获取多个Pod的信息 kubectl get pods pod1 pod2 #获取多种对象类型信息 kubectl get pod/pod1 rc/rc1 #同时应用多个...YAML文件,以多个-f file参数表示 kubectl get pod -f pod1.yaml -f pod2.yaml kubectl create -f pod1.yaml -f pod2.yaml...--certificate-authority= 用于CA授权的cert文件路径 --client-certificate= 用于TLS的客户端证书文件路径 --client-key= 用于TLS的客户端...--vmodule= glog基于模块的详细日志级别 2.5.kubectl输出格式 kubectl命令可以用多种格式对结果进行显示,输出的格式通过-o参 数指定: kubectl [command...c /bin/bash 3.6.查看容器的日志 #查看容器输出到stdout的日志 kubectl logs #跟踪查看容器的日志,相当于tail

    92720

    kubernetes 部署Web-UI界面

    apply -f https://kuboard.cn/install-script/kuboard.yaml kubectl apply -f https://addons.kuboard.cn/metrics-server...READY STATUS RESTARTS AGE kuboard-7986796cf8-ml2kh 1/1 Running 0 16m 获取Token...运维团队搭建好 Kubernetes 之后,需要授权开发/测试团队的成员执行某些特定的操作,例如更新镜像版本、查看容器日志、进入容器终端、通过Proxy访问接口等,以便开发测试人员可以自行完成日常的测试联调等任务...使用 Kubernetes + Kuboard 的团队可能以如下几种形式授权开发、测试人员访问: 为开发团队、测试团队创建各自的 ServiceAccount,并授权其访问指定的名称空间,请参考: 使用...Kuboard管理ServiceAccount及RBAC; 授权 kuboard-viewer 查看日志 与自建的 gitlab / github 实现单点登录,并授权 gitlab / github

    1.2K20

    二进制部署k8s教程14 - 部署coredns

    linux_amd64.tgz && \tar -zxvf coredns_1.10.0_linux_amd64.tgz && \mv coredns /usr/local/bin/1.创建目录# 创建日志存放目录...NOTEcoredns 需要访问 kube-apiserver 获取数据。需要 kube-apiserver 的 ca 机构为其颁发客户端 client 证书。...NOTE除了需要创建客户端证书外,还需要创建 RBAC 授权。因为前面部署的 kube-apiserver 开启了 RBAC 鉴权。这里的集群用户跟上面创建客户端证书指定的用户一致:coredns。...直接打印日志文件查看没有显示任何错误表示启动成功cat /var/log/coredns/coredns.log显示如下,没有任何错误.:53[INFO] plugin/reload: Running...configuration SHA512 = 75a7e545d2e00af59a3f1984d819f3b35db009002c603603942190c2fe71d13d8a0a86e605e4d42ad2027f8fd9b21ef4a765811b68fde1a0ffc89ce752387c51CoreDNS

    67820
    领券